Middlewood train station has a minimalistic set up, a true reflection of its peaceful, countryside location. It doesn't feature a ticket office or machines, so passengers should plan to purchase tickets online or from nearby stations before arriving. However, there is an induction loop available, ensuring that travelers with hearing impairments can receive assistance.
With step-free access provided to the Buxton platform, although other areas, such as the Manchester platform, are only accessible via steps, Middlewood might present challenges for those with mobility issues. Travelers should plan accordingly and may request assistance from the conductor upon arrival. There's no waiting room or refreshment facilities, but there is seating available for those needing a brief respite during their travels.

Bromborough Station is a testament to the quintessentially British experience of straightforward, no-frills commuting. Tickets cannot be collected from a ticket office or machine as none are available on-site. While this might seem inconvenient, it offers an opportunity to purchase travel fares more flexibly via online platforms, with convenient smartcard options available for regular commuters.
Accessibility could be improved at the station. As categorized as a 'Category C' station, visitors should note that Bromborough does not offer step-free access to its platforms. Those in need of accessible services should consider heading to the nearby Bromborough Rake station which caters more comprehensively to those requiring additional mobility support.
While it lacks extensive facilities, Bromborough station offers essential comforts such as seating areas and basic waiting rooms to ensure a degree of comfort while waiting for your train. For those snack emergencies, there are refreshment facilities available in the form of a food vending machine. However, bear in mind that there are no public Wi-Fi services or ATM machines available.
The car park offers free spaces, including four spaces dedicated to accessible parking, although no accessible taxis service the station directly. Cyclists can take advantage of 76 cycle storage spaces with secure options. CCTV cameras ensure the security of both parked cars and bicycles.
Although no taxi rank exists at Bromborough Station, travel connections to local bus services provide a seamless transition from train to road.
